CVE-2024-13665: Admire Extra <= 1.6 - Authenticated (Contributor+) Stored Cross-Site Scripting

The Admire Extra plugin for WordPress is vulnerable to Stored Cross-Site Scripting via the plugin's 'space' shortcode in all versions up to, and including, 1.6 due to insufficient input sanitization and output escaping on user supplied attributes. This makes it possible for authenticated attackers, with contributor-level access and above, to inject arbitrary web scripts in pages that will execute whenever a user accesses an injected page.

Plain-English summary

CVE-2024-13665 affects the WordPress Admire Extra plugin up to version 1.6. A logged-in user with Contributor-level access or higher can store malicious script through the plugin's space shortcode. The script runs when someone views the affected page, creating risk to user sessions and site trust.

Executive priority

Treat as a moderate-priority WordPress content security issue. It is not described as unauthenticated takeover, but it can expose users to malicious scripts on trusted pages.

Technical view

The issue is stored cross-site scripting in Admire Extra's space shortcode, caused by insufficient input sanitization and output escaping of user-supplied attributes. It is tracked as CWE-79 with CVSS 3.1 score 6.4. Exploitation requires authenticated low-privilege WordPress access and impacts confidentiality and integrity, not availability.

Likely exposure

Exposure is most likely on WordPress sites running Admire Extra version 1.6 or earlier, especially where Contributor, Author, Editor, or Administrator accounts can create shortcode content.

Exploitation context

The provided sources do not show KEV listing or active exploitation. Abuse requires an authenticated Contributor-level or higher account, then stored script execution when an injected page is viewed.

Mitigation direction

  • Check whether Admire Extra is installed and identify its version.
  • Update or remove Admire Extra according to vendor or WordPress plugin guidance.
  • Restrict Contributor-level and higher access to trusted users only.
  • Review pages and posts using the space shortcode.
  • Monitor WordPress accounts for suspicious content changes.

Validation and detection

  • Inventory WordPress sites for the Admire Extra plugin.
  • Confirm no site runs Admire Extra version 1.6 or earlier.
  • Review shortcode content created by Contributor-level or higher users.
  • Verify role assignments do not grant unnecessary content creation permissions.
  • Check vendor references for the applicable patched release or changeset.
